E3 Ubiquitin-Protein Ligase Parkin (Parkin)

Target
Parkin
Molecular classification
Enzyme, E3 ubiquitin ligase, RBR-type E3 ubiquitin ligase
01

Overview

E3 Ubiquitin-Protein Ligase Parkin is a key enzyme involved in the ubiquitin-proteasome system and mitochondrial quality control. As an E3 ubiquitin ligase, it facilitates the attachment of ubiquitin to target proteins, marking them for degradation or other cellular processes like mitophagy. Mutations in the PRKN gene, which encodes parkin, are a major cause of early-onset Parkinson's disease, highlighting its critical role in neuronal survival and function.
